Keto Kung Pao Pizza
Keto Kung Pao Pizza is a delightful fusion dish that combines the bold flavors of Kung Pao chicken with a low-carb pizza base, perfect for those on a keto diet. This inventive recipe delivers a satisfying crunch and savory taste, making it a guilt-free indulgence for pizza lovers.

Ingredients
- Almond flour - 1 cup
- Mozzarella cheese (shredded) - 1 cup
- Cream cheese - 100 grams
- Egg - 1 large
- Baking powder - 1 tsp
- Cooked chicken breast (diced) - 150 grams
- Red bell pepper (diced) - 1/2 medium
- Green onion (sliced) - 2 stalks
- Roasted peanuts (chopped) - 30 grams
- Soy sauce (low sodium) - 2 tbsp
- Rice vinegar - 1 tbsp
- Szechuan peppercorns (crushed) - 1/2 tsp
- Garlic (minced) - 2 cloves
- Ginger (minced) - 1 tsp
- Sesame oil - 1 tsp
- Chili paste (optional) - 1 tsp
Steps
- Preheat your oven to 200°C (400°F).
- In a mixing bowl, combine almond flour, shredded mozzarella cheese, cream cheese, egg, and baking powder to form a dough.
- Spread the dough onto a parchment-lined pizza pan, shaping it into a pizza base.
- Bake the crust in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es until golden brown.
- While the crust is baking, heat sesame o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add minced garlic, ginger, and Szechuan peppercorns, sautéing until fragrant.
- Add the diced chicken, red bell pepper, soy sauce, rice vinegar, and chili paste (if using) to the skillet, stirring to combine. Cook for about 5-7 minutes until heated through.
- Remove the crust from the oven and evenly spread the chicken mixture over the hot crust.
- Sprinkle chopped roasted peanuts and sliced green onions on top.
- Return the pizza to the oven and bake for an additional 5 minutes.
- Slice and serve hot, garnished with extra green onions if desired.
